Marj is a name often given to girls. Ranked #7187 and holds a steady place on the charts. It comes from a English origin and traditionally means "Pearl or bitter". It has 1 syllable.
Marj stems from Margaret in English tradition. It offers simplicity and strength. Modern use revives its retro charm.
